    BANDS…

    1. ANCST (Post Black Metal - Berlin): Berlins ANCST, with folks from AFTERLIFE KIDS and HENRY FONDA, play powerful black metal in combination with neo-crust. Their music sounds so goddamn fresh and in-your-face because of the absence of all these depressed and gloomy elements, which other black metal bands often have. Check out their first album - “In Turmoil” - it’s already their magnum opus. http://angstnoise.bandcamp.com/album/in-turmoil

    2. DAILY RITUAL (Punkrock - Singapur): Singapores DAILY RITUAL is a political punk rock band - great songs, great melodies, somewhere between RED DONS, AUTISTIC YOUTH and NEON PISS. Their actual 7”inch - “Depressed State” - is a little shining gem. http://dailyritual.bandcamp.com/

    3. CLOUD RAT (Grindcore - USA): CLOUD RAT is a three-piece grindcore ensemble from Michigan/USA. No doubt, this is one of the best bands in the genre worldwide. Even big metal magazines payed them a lot of attention and albums like "Moksha", their first full length, can be filed under the instant classics section. Old school grind with a top notch vocalist, plus influences from screamo-HC and if you wanna believe it - there are some dirty punk rock tunes under the blast beats. Awesome! http://cloudrat.bandcamp.com/

    4. RED APOLLO (dark HC/Metal - Dortmund): RED APOLLO (with overlappings to SUNDOWNING) played the KIEL EXPLODW festival before and we’re happy, that they will come back to Kiel. They have become better, but their style is the same: dark HC, (black) metal and doom. References could be ISIS, mixed with the actual stuff from DOWNFALL OF GAIA. RED APOLLO’s new album - “Altruist” - we’re sure about that, will be one of the top releases for 2015. http://redapollo.bandcamp.com/

    5. THRÄNENKIND (Post Rock/Metal - München-Hamburg): THRÄNENKIND started as black metal band. Things changed and the band made a huge step in their development, especially with albums like “The Elk” or their fantastic 7”inch “Hope(less)”. The current THRÄNENKIND play dark, gloomy and metallic post rock and the old black metal past, is always there. Overall, an absolutely unique band. http://thraenenkind.bandcamp.com/album/hope-less

    6. PHANTOM WINTER (Doom/Sludge - Würzburg): May 2014 - the worst shit of the decade happens: OMEGA MASSIF called it quits. Our faces melt, gloomy depressions follow. THE biggest post metal band ever with unbelieveable live qualities (https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=xuKcCnsST6U), gone forever. But someone hears our screaming: ex-OMEGA MASSIF members form a new band called PHANTOM WINTER. The riffs sound sluggish, brutal and heavy as hell. Doom, sludge and black metal rolled into one, this time with vocals. Our desperation has found an end. https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=QfQkAUl0BTI

    7. THE TIDAL SLEEP (Screamo/Post-HC - Mannheim…Leipzig): TIDAL SLEEP - perhaps THE band when things come to emotional, modern sounding HC with roots in the 90s emo/screamo scene. If you like bands like TOUCHE ARMORE, you must love THE TIDAL SLEEP. Plus this band (with members from GLASSES & TRAINWRECK) has unearthly live qualities. http://thetidalsleep.bandcamp.com/

    8. THURM (Screamo/Post Black Metal - Paderborn): THURM is a brandnew band with folks who played music in bands like ANTEATER and AMBER. These two names may gave you a hint what is to be expect: screamo-HC, post rock and crushing black metal. Epic songs which are sometimes longer than 10 minutes. Their first full length will be out before the festival and what's even better...on vocals you will find Anna, the ex-singer from AMBER.
